4 Troubleshooting
4�1 Faults and Solutions
Display Fault Name Possible Causes Solutions
Err02 Overcurrent during
acceleration
1� The output circuit is short circuited�
2� The acceleration time is too short�
3� Manual torque boost or V/F curve is not
appropriate�
4� The power supply is too low
5� The startup operation is performed on the
rotating motor
6� A sudden load is added during acceleration�
7� The AC drive model is of too small power
class�
1: Eliminate short circuit�
2: Increase the acceleration time�
3: Adjust the manual torque boost or V/F curve�
4: Check that the power supply is normal�
5: Select speed tracking restart or start the motor
after it stops�
6: Remove the added load�
7: Select a drive of higher power class�
Err03 Overcurrent during
deceleration
1� The output circuit is short circuited�
2� The deceleration time is too short�
3� The power supply is too low
4� A sudden load is added during deceleration�
5� The braking resistor is not installed�
1: Eliminate short circuit�
2: Increase the deceleration time�
3: Check the power supply, and ensure it is
normal�
4: Remove the added load�
5: Install the braking resistor
Err04 Overcurrent at
constant speed
1� The output circuit is short circuited�
2� The power supply is too low
3� A sudden load is added during operation�
4� The AC drive model is of too small power
class�
1: Eliminate short circuit�
2: Adjust power supply to normal range�
3: Remove the added load�
4: Select a drive of higher power class�
Err05 Overvoltage during
acceleration
1� The DC bus voltage is too high�
2� An external force drives the motor during
acceleration�
3� The acceleration time is too short�
4� The braking resistor is not installed�
1: Replace with a proper braking resistor
2: Cancel the external force or install braking
resistor
3: Increase the acceleration time�
4: Install a braking resistor
Err06 Overvoltage during
deceleration
1� The DC bus voltage is too high�
2� An external force drives the motor during
deceleration�
3� The deceleration time is too short�
4� The braking resistor is not installed�
1: Replace with a proper braking resistor
2: Cancel the external force or install braking
resistor
3: Increase the deceleration time�
4: Install the braking resistor
Err07 Overvoltage at
constant speed
1� The DC bus voltage is too high�
2� An external force drives the motor during
deceleration�
1: Replace with a proper braking resistor
2: Cancel the external force�
Voltage thresholds
Voltage Class DC Bus Overvoltage DC Bus Undervoltage Braking Unit Operation Level
Single-phase 220 V 400V 200V 381V
Three-phase 220 V 400V 200V 381V
Three-phase 380 V 810V 350V 700V

Inovance MD310 T1.5B Specifications

General IconGeneral
Power1.5 kW
Storage Temperature-20°C to +60°C
Power Supply Voltage380-480 VAC
Control ModeV/F control, Sensorless vector control
Protection FeaturesOver-voltage, Under-voltage, Over-current, Overload, Short-circuit
Communication InterfaceRS485, Modbus RTU
Operating Temperature-10°C to +40°C
Humidity5% to 95% (non-condensing)
AltitudeUp to 1000 m
